I want to move from my personal Microsoft monthly subscription of Outlook to a Family subscription of Microsoft Family Account - how can I go about it? I pay AED 7 monthly for access to Outlook and OneDrive?

    Yes, you can move to a Microsoft Family plan even if it’s under your brother’s account.

    To help narrow down the issue:

    1. Has your brother already sent you an invite, or not yet?
    2. Is your current plan active right now or already expired?

    If you haven’t already, here’s how it works:

    • Ask your brother to invite you to the Microsoft Family subscription
    • He can do this from his Microsoft account > Services & subscriptions: https://account.microsoft.com/services Share with family
    • You accept the invite using your own Microsoft account

    Once you join, you’ll get the benefits (Outlook, OneDrive storage, etc.) under your account.

    For your current personal subscription: You don’t need to transfer it. Just turn off recurring billing or cancel it to avoid being charged twice.


    After successfully accepting invite:

    • Check if you able to see your Microsoft 365 Family subscription under the Services & subscriptions page here: https://account.microsoft.com/services and if it is active.
    • If active, open any Office app (like Word or Excel), go to File > Account, and click "Update License" to refresh your subscription status.

    To move from a Microsoft 365 Personal–type subscription to Microsoft 365 Family, the process depends on how the current subscription was purchased.

    1. If the subscription was bought directly from Microsoft (not via Apple/Google/retailer):
      1. Go to https://account.microsoft.com/services and sign in with the same Microsoft account used for the current subscription.
      2. Buy a Microsoft 365 Family subscription using that same account.
      3. The remaining days on the current subscription will automatically convert and be added to the new Family subscription. The exact number of days added depends on the plan being upgraded from and to.
      4. No need to reinstall apps when switching between Microsoft 365 Personal and Microsoft 365 Family.
    2. If the subscription was purchased through a third party (Apple App Store, Google Play, or another retailer):
      1. Manage the subscription through that billing provider (for example, Apple Subscriptions or Google Play Subscriptions).
      2. Cancel or change the existing plan there. Some third‑party providers may not support direct switching to another Microsoft 365 plan; in that case, cancel first, then after the cancellation period, purchase Microsoft 365 Family as a new subscription.
      3. If purchased from the iOS app specifically as Microsoft 365 Personal, cancel it in iOS Settings > [your name] > Subscriptions, wait until it is fully cancelled (up to 15 days after the scheduled renewal date), then return to Subscriptions to purchase Microsoft 365 Family.

    After switching to Microsoft 365 Family, Outlook and OneDrive access continue under the new plan, and the subscription benefits can be shared with family members.
